The boundaries of urban health policy: local powers, cholera morbus and social dynamics in Sicily in 1837. The projects of the strange “reorder” of the Civita District in Catania
The aim of this paper is to highlight the historical events of a city of the Kingdom of the Two Sicilies in the first decades of the nineteenth century, facing the realisation of some urban interventions aimed at improving the conditions of public health within a district with health risk.
